Kodamadagu Population - Tumkur, Karnataka
Kodamadagu is a medium size village located in Pavagada Taluka of Tumkur district, Karnataka with total 306 families residing. The Kodamadagu village has population of 1347 of which 673 are males while 674 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kodamadagu village population of children with age 0-6 is 142 which makes up 10.54 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kodamadagu village is 1001 which is higher than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Kodamadagu as per census is 1119, higher than Karnataka average of 948.
Kodamadagu village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Kodamadagu village was 62.16 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Kodamadagu Male literacy stands at 70.30 % while female literacy rate was 53.92 %.

Kodamadagu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 306 | - | - |
Population | 1,347 | 673 | 674 |
Child (0-6) | 142 | 67 | 75 |
Schedule Caste | 268 | 131 | 137 |
Schedule Tribe | 255 | 122 | 133 |
Literacy | 62.16 % | 70.30 % | 53.92 % |
Total Workers | 722 | 412 | 310 |
Main Worker | 673 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 49 | 20 | 29 |
